Pine Castle sets an easygoing lakeside rhythm just south of Orlando, with tree-lined streets, mid-century homes, and quick access to major job centers. Bordered by the Conway Chain of Lakes and Lake Jessamine, it offers an everyday connection to the water, while nearby Edgewood and Belle Isle add additional dining, parks, and community amenities. Commuters appreciate being minutes from Orlando International Airport, SunRail’s Sand Lake Road corridor, and key thoroughfares, all within unincorporated Orange County.
Outdoorsy weekends practically plan themselves. The oak-canopied paths and playgrounds at Cypress Grove Park lead to lake breezes and picnic spots, and the historic estate on-site is a local landmark for events; see the county details for amenities and hours at Cypress Grove Park’s official page. Tennis courts, a boat ramp, and kayak-friendly shoreline make Warren Park a go-to for sunrise paddles and post-work rallies; the county page for Warren Park lists everything from court availability to pavilion rentals. Families benefit from highly regarded district resources through Orange County Public Schools; explore programs, school calendars, and enrollment at the OCPS website.
Local flavor thrives along South Orange Avenue, where mom-and-pop eateries, international markets, and everyday services cluster close to home. Seasonal traditions like Pine Castle Pioneer Days celebrate the area’s deep-rooted heritage and small-town warmth beside the city’s energy.
